Cheshire is an unincorporated community in Delaware County, in the U.S. state of Ohio. [1]
The first store opened at Cheshire in 1847. [2] The town site was platted in 1849. [3] The post office at Cheshire was called Constantia. [2] This post office was established in 1851, and remained in operation until 1904. [4] [5]
